Cellular phenotypes associated with NRXN1 mutations in autism : an iPSC study

2021-01-01

Abstract excerpt

Autism spectrum conditions are neurodevelopmental conditions that entail social- communication difficulties, unusually narrow interests and difficulties adjusting to unexpected change. While the role of NRXN1 has been established in regulating normal synaptic function and physiology, its contribution to the aetiology of autism is only now emerging.
